Projeto Ruido is a Portuguese mural duo based in Porto, made up of Frederico Draw and Rodrigo Miguel. Active since the mid-2010s, it develops a monumental figurative painting centred on portraiture: faces of residents, workers and elders rendered in black and white or ochre, with charcoal-like linework and strong contrasts. A double mural of nearly 400 m² (two walls of 19.5 × 9 m) painted in September 2024 by the Portuguese duo Projeto Ruido in the Torrero district of Zaragoza, as part of the 19th edition of the Festival Asalto. It pays tribute to the sports that shaped the neighbourhood's history until 1957: footballer José Luis Violeta, known as "the lion of Torrero", cyclist José Catalán and Alicia Simón, a local figure tied to the Iberia club. The portraits are rendered in the duo's documentary style, blending photographic screen-print feel with fresco painting.
